About
Justin Kalmbach is a dedicated attorney serving clients in criminal defense, family law, estate planning, probate, and civil litigation. Through Kalmbach Law Office, PLLC, he provides practical legal guidance to individuals and families facing serious decisions, contested disputes, criminal allegations, and important planning needs in Montana and Alaska.
Justin earned his Juris Doctor from the University of Montana School of Law in 2008. Before law school, he earned a Bachelor of Arts in Business Administration with a major in accounting and a minor in communication from the University of Washington in 2004, providing him with a strong analytical foundation. His legal career includes public defense work with the Confederated Salish and Kootenai Tribal Public Defenders Offices, where he served as a civil attorney.
In family law, Justin helps clients address divorce, legal separation, child custody, adoption, and related concerns with clear communication and careful preparation. His work supports people during difficult transitions by helping them understand available options, protect important relationships, and pursue practical outcomes that reflect their legal priorities. His criminal defense practice includes representation in adult and juvenile matters. He assists clients facing investigations, charges, hearings, negotiations, and court proceedings, helping them understand their rights and respond effectively.
Justin Kalmbach also assists with estate planning, wills, trusts, probate, and civil litigation. These services help clients plan for future needs, protect assets, manage estate administration, and resolve disputes. His accounting background supports careful review of financial and property issues often involved in planning, probate, and litigation matters. He is licensed in Montana state and federal courts, Alaska state and federal courts, the Tribal Court of the Confederated Salish and Kootenai Tribes, and the Ninth Circuit Court of Appeals.
